My boy got a CO for Infocomm to HCI, but eventually, he give up as RI math WL converted into CO. He chose RI because of the distance.
Hi, anyone DSA Infocomms/Robotics & successfully got CO to HCI? Please share your DS's portfolio - CCA, academic & Robotics competition etc. Is there any selection test, to perform any specific task? If yes, what was involved in the selection test? Also what are some of the interview questions being asked? Was is group or 1-to-1 interview? Tia for kind parents sharing.
He learned Scratch, Python, and C++. Finished 200+ questions in codebreakers, and win a few MO awards plus an HCIC award. Forget to mention, we shared 200 C++ code files when asked to provide supporting documents.
The interview is a group interview of 2 teachers and 3 pupils. They are asked to do 2 logic & programming problems within 30 mins. -

Just wondering whether anybody not in IMSO but with Gold in NMOS, SPSO received CO from RI in Math or Science domain?
For a ref, my boy has 2 SMOPS platinum, gold NMOS, siler RSO, D in RIPWMC. AL level 6-7. The possible reason that he only get a WL instead of a CO:
1. Only D in RIPMWC, no 2round. For RI, RIPWMC might take the most weight.
2. He did not manage to get top 30 in all these MOs.
Hope these benchmark info helps DSA applicants for next year. -
